Marin Shakespeare Presents TWELFTH NIGHT, OR ALL YOU NEED IS LOVE 7/25 Thru 9/27
Welcome to Illyria, the most hip, far out, psychedelic place in the world! So begins Robert and Lesley Currier's adaptation of "Twelfth Night, or All You Need is Love," a 1960-70's music-filled adaptation of Shakespeare's "Twelfth Night," the gender bender romantic comedy where women woo their men -- as boys. Featuring William Elsman, Alexandra Matthew, Jack Powell and Cat Thompson. Directed by Robert and Lesley Currier.
